Summary:

Manages and directs design staff. Assists Project Manager and Project Superintendent in establishing the construction plan; interfaces daily with production team and other relevant constituencies for evaluation of changes to model. Transforms initial rough product designs using computer aided design into working documents.

 

Role and Responsibilities

  1. Uses BIM and VDC for electrical system design and documentation
  2. Prepares clear, complete, and accurate 3D models and 2D drawings for projects.
  3. Implement designs from superintendent’s sketches or from other documentation.
  4. Coordinates 3D models to resolve collisions with other trades.
  5. Takes responsibility for own work produced to a high standard.
  6. Ensure output meets the required standards and meet agreed deadlines.

 

Qualifications and Education Requirements

  • Strong knowledge and experience in Revit, Navisworks, AutoCAD, and other Autodesk Software.
  • Bluebeam Drawing Review experience.
  • Associates degree in drafting or minimum of 5 years related experience.
  • Demonstrated ability to complete assignments on time and on schedule.
  • Solid understanding of drafting techniques.
  • Working as a lead member of the drafting team cooperating with the production team members on each project.
  • An understanding and ability to effectively use Microsoft Windows, Microsoft Word, Microsoft Excel, Outlook, and other office related software.
  • Strong written, verbal, mathematical, and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ability and willingness to learn new programs as required.
